Commit Graph

86 Commits

Author SHA1 Message Date
peter
e24474d9ac * -Ur switch (merged)
* masm fixes (merged)
  * quoted filenames for go32v2 and win32
2001-06-18 20:36:23 +00:00
peter
50ddd43c70 * smartlink with dll fixed (merged) 2001-06-13 18:31:57 +00:00
peter
7583ae7d01 * used target_asm.id instead of target_info.assem 2001-04-21 15:34:49 +00:00
peter
0c03535b5b * registration of targets and assemblers 2001-04-18 22:01:53 +00:00
peter
a7cf57524e * symtable change to classes
* range check generation and errors fixed, make cycle DEBUG=1 works
  * memory leaks fixed
2001-04-13 01:22:06 +00:00
peter
eb95f58e21 * don't create temporary smartlink dir for internalassembler 2001-03-13 18:42:39 +00:00
peter
1b1f938c43 * changed to class with common TAssembler also for internal assembler 2001-03-05 21:39:11 +00:00
michael
0a8415f483 * bug correction: pipes must be closed by pclose (not close);
There was too many not closed processes under Linux before patch.
  Test this by making a compiler under Linux with command
    OPT="-P" make
  and check a list of processes in another shell with
    ps -xa
2001-02-26 08:08:16 +00:00
peter
3ea409ab44 * tasm/masm fixes merged 2001-02-20 21:36:39 +00:00
peter
38305e0a1a * fixed uninited var 2001-02-09 23:06:17 +00:00
peter
eda26e9190 * support linux unit for ver1_0 compilers 2001-02-05 20:46:59 +00:00
marco
ad6ba5dd70 * Renamefest. Compiler part. Not that hard. 2001-01-21 20:32:45 +00:00
peter
5ea6603165 * fixed searching for utils 2001-01-12 19:19:44 +00:00
peter
32b9cdb7cf + new tlinkedlist class (merge of old tstringqueue,tcontainer and
tlinkedlist objects)
2000-12-25 00:07:25 +00:00
marco
b65958a61e * Renamefest 2000-11-13 15:26:12 +00:00
peter
38951f5ce1 * lot of compile updates for cg11 2000-10-01 19:48:23 +00:00
peter
a71e44ac49 * use defines.inc 2000-09-24 15:06:10 +00:00
peter
4c94659743 * moved some util functions from globals,cobjects to cutils
* splitted files into finput,fmodule
2000-08-27 16:11:48 +00:00
michael
665c1f6410 + patched to 1.1.0 with former 1.09patch from peter 2000-07-13 12:08:24 +00:00
michael
650fbb86aa + removed logs 2000-07-13 11:32:24 +00:00
michael
e7aca136a1 + Initial import 2000-07-13 06:29:38 +00:00
peter
120d2f0130 * added ifdef fpc around findclose 2000-06-01 19:11:19 +00:00
peter
65d78b71d2 * clean .o and .s from smartlinkpath when starting the writer 2000-06-01 13:02:45 +00:00
pierre
d9fc5de9ac + accept nasmwin32 output 2000-04-04 15:05:03 +00:00
peter
2ba0ebe607 * removed warnings/notes 2000-02-24 18:41:38 +00:00
peter
4a4a24b6e8 * log truncated 2000-02-09 13:22:42 +00:00
peter
6607475609 * fixed placing of .sl directories
* use -b again for base-file selection
  * fixed group writing for linux with smartlinking
2000-01-11 09:52:06 +00:00
peter
e525797c51 * updated copyright to 2000 2000-01-07 01:14:18 +00:00
peter
e169c592f8 * searchpaths changed to stringqueue object 1999-11-12 11:03:49 +00:00
peter
df694c76e8 * filename fixes for win32 imports for units with multiple needed dll's 1999-11-08 10:37:12 +00:00
peter
0887060ff2 * truncated log to 20 revs 1999-11-06 14:34:16 +00:00
peter
19443ae269 * import library fixes for win32
* alignment works again
1999-11-02 15:06:56 +00:00
pierre
910372616a * typo correction 1999-09-16 11:34:44 +00:00
daniel
1777e0c901 * Could not compile with TP, some arrays moved to heap
* NOAG386BIN default for TP
  * AG386* files were not compatible with TP, fixed.
1999-09-02 18:47:41 +00:00
florian
046acfb84b * made it compilable with Dlephi 4 again
+ fixed problem with large stack allocations on win32
1999-07-18 10:19:38 +00:00
peter
b867e4f6de * assembler smartlink message 1999-07-10 10:12:03 +00:00
peter
1e75d2d672 * better smartlinking support 1999-07-03 00:27:02 +00:00
peter
438c1e07b6 * merged 1999-06-28 16:02:29 +00:00
peter
0b272f13c7 * removed oldasm
* plabel -> pasmlabel
  * -a switches to source writing automaticly
  * assembler readers OOPed
  * asmsymbol automaticly external
  * jumptables and other label fixes for asm readers
1999-05-27 19:43:55 +00:00
peter
a47afc3857 * removed oldppu code
* warning if objpas is loaded from uses
  * first things for new deref writing
1999-05-13 21:59:19 +00:00
peter
4841b4236c * updated messages 1999-05-05 22:21:47 +00:00
florian
78d13ec796 * changes to compile it with Delphi 4.0 1999-05-04 21:44:30 +00:00
peter
3f6fafc495 * don't include ag386bin for oldasm 1999-05-02 23:28:42 +00:00
peter
adda83dac6 * moved section names to systems
* fixed nasm,intel writer
1999-05-02 22:41:46 +00:00
peter
611da2d24e * merged nasm compiler
* old asm moved to oldasm/
1999-05-01 13:23:57 +00:00
peter
d0cb5a147a * fixed bugs 212,222,225,227,229,231,233 1999-03-24 23:16:42 +00:00
peter
461a11158e + .a writer 1999-03-18 20:30:44 +00:00
peter
f4c74e4a3d * synchronize also the objfile for ag386bin 1999-03-01 15:43:48 +00:00
peter
a17c03cca3 * assembler writers fixed for ag386bin 1999-02-26 00:48:13 +00:00
peter
e25d934e2f * small updates for ag386bin 1999-02-24 00:59:11 +00:00